Jyrgalan
Jyrgalang is a village in the Ak-Suu District of Issyk-Kul Region of Kyrgyzstan. It is located at the right bank of the river Jyrgalang. It was established in 1964 to support operation of a coal mine Jyrgalan.Jyrgalan
